Lake City, Fl vs Chisasibi/ Fort George, Quebec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Lake City, Fl, Usa and Chisasibi/ Fort George, Quebec, Canada is approximately 2,669 km or 1,659 mi.
  • To reach Lake City, Fl in this distance one would set out from Chisasibi/ Fort George, Quebec bearing 188.4°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Lake City, Fl bearing 185.7° or S .
  • Lake City, Fl has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Chisasibi/ Fort George, Quebec has a boreal subarctic climate with dry summers (Dsc).
  • The average annual temperature is 22.9 °C (41.1°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.7 °C (33.7°F) less in Lake City, Fl.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 800.4 mm (31.5 in) more which is equivalent to 800.4 l/m² (19.64 US gal/ft²) or 8,004,000 l/ha (855,681 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.8° higher in Lake City, Fl than in Chisasibi/ Fort George, Quebec.
